The Environmental Impact of Tallow Use
While tallow may seem like a natural skincare alternative, it raises concerns regarding sustainability. The livestock industry is significant in environmental degradation, contributing to deforestation and greenhouse gas emissions. For those who prioritize eco-conscious choices, the question becomes: can we find alternatives that mitigate these impacts while still maintaining effective skincare regimes?
Potential Skin Irritation from Animal Products
Individuals with sensitive skin may find that animal-based products, including tallow, can provoke allergies or skin irritations. For many, incorporating plant-based oils, such as jojoba or coconut oil, could yield better results without the risk of adverse reactions. It’s essential to listen to your skin’s needs and choose products that align with both your body's responses and your ethical stance.
Exploring Vegan and Plant-Based Alternatives
With the rise of vegan lifestyles, the beauty industry is brimming with plant-derived moisturizers and treatments matching or exceeding the benefits claimed by tallow proponents. Ingredients such as shea butter and avocado oil not only boost hydration but also align with a more sustainable outlook on beauty.
